The batteries in the remote are new and the sticker was gone. It was
the same with three different remotes.
I think the problem was with the IR window in the faceplate not lining
up with the receiver properly. When I removed the faceplate, the
remote worked from 30 feet with no problem. Fortunately I had a spare
black faceplate, so I simply cut a 1 inch hole in the plate where the
IR window was. Now the remote works great! It actually doesn't look
that bad either. Since its black you really can't see the hole unless
you get right up to it and look.
